Our People

The Bio-imaging and Sensing Center  draws expertise from researchers in  varied disciplinesat North Dakota  State University. Beyond NDSU, we collaborate with other  institutions in the United States and around the world. Our past collaborators include Iowa State University; the University of Minnesota; the University of Arkansas; the Institute of Agricultural Engineering, Bet Dagan, Israel; and Beijing University, China. We work with USDA laboratories, including those in Fargo and East Grand Forks, Minn.

We have cooperated with international industrial sectors in the United Kingdom, the Netherlands and France. Our partners in the United States have included companies such as Simplot, Melroe Co., and Ag. Leader Technology. We also work with individuals and groups of growers, small and large food and grain processors, and equipment manufacturers in North Dakota and other states around the country.
